Product Management Trade-Off Question: Balancing organic produce variety and pricing at Whole Foods Market

Introduction

Balancing the variety of organic produce with maintaining lower prices for customers is a critical trade-off for Whole Foods Market. This scenario touches on core aspects of Whole Foods' value proposition and customer experience. I'll analyze this trade-off by examining the business context, customer impact, and potential strategies to optimize this balance.

Analysis Approach

I'd like to start by asking a few clarifying questions to ensure we're aligned on the key aspects of this trade-off before diving into a detailed analysis.

Step 1

Clarifying Questions (3 minutes)

  • Based on recent market trends, I'm thinking organic produce variety might be a key differentiator for Whole Foods. Could you share how our organic produce selection compares to major competitors?

Why it matters: Helps assess the competitive landscape and potential for differentiation Expected answer: Whole Foods has a wider variety but at a premium price Impact on approach: Would influence whether to focus on variety expansion or price optimization

  • Considering our customer segments, I'm assuming price sensitivity varies. Can you provide insights into how our different customer segments respond to price changes versus variety expansion?

Why it matters: Allows for targeted strategies that balance variety and price for different segments Expected answer: Core organic shoppers value variety more, while occasional shoppers are more price-sensitive Impact on approach: Would guide segmented pricing and assortment strategies

  • Looking at our supply chain, I'm curious about the scalability of our organic produce sourcing. How flexible is our current supplier network in terms of expanding variety without significantly increasing costs?

Why it matters: Determines the feasibility of expanding variety without major price increases Expected answer: Some flexibility exists, but significant expansion would require new partnerships Impact on approach: Would influence the pace and scale of variety expansion efforts

  • Considering our overall business strategy, how does the organic produce category contribute to our revenue and profit margins compared to other departments?

Why it matters: Helps prioritize resources and efforts in the context of overall business performance Expected answer: Organic produce is a key driver of both revenue and customer loyalty Impact on approach: Would justify more aggressive strategies to optimize this category
